CHARLESTON, W.Va. (AP) - A man has been sentenced to 40 years in prison for the beating death of a man under a highway bridge near Magic Island last year.

The Charleston Gazette (https://bit.ly/1A1OYQ1 ) reports a judge sentenced 20-year-old Anthony Harriman Wednesday. Harriman pleaded guilty to second-degree murder in the death of 51-year-old Martin Snodgrass last year.

Snodgrass’ wife, Vicky, says her husband was walking along Magic Island after work when he was attacked. Harriman was homeless at the time.

Prosecutors say Snodgrass did nothing to provoke the attack. They dropped a first-degree murder charge after Harriman pleaded guilty to the lesser offense and agreed to cooperate with authorities in two other cases.
